We are looking for a dynamic team player Accountant (Asst / Manager), who will lead the Accounting/Finance & HR/Admin. This role offers great independence by working across various team members to support the growth plans of the company. This role will be working closely with management for various aspects of strategy and growth.
Job Description
Responsible for full set of accounting & finance related responsibilities.
Some production accounting experience for costings purposes would be advantageous. Highly suitable for accountants looking for production related experience as well as looking to develop leadership skills.
Basic consolidation and reconciliation of accounts, prepare accurate and timely month end closing reports and necessary schedules.
Some HR, IT and Administration experience will be coupled with the role and able to think strategically to work with the team and the Director to formulate growth plans for the company.
Work closely with external auditors, bankers, regulators, and stakeholders.
Able to work independently and translate various business functions into an evolving accounting view, like investments to cash flows, inventory, and production related overviews.
Strategic thinking with a team player attitude and be the expert of the Microsoft Navision system and develop relevant users including production modules.
Job Requirements
Candidate must possess at least a Bachelor's degree / Professional Degree in Accountancy and a great passion for reconciling accounts and analyzing financial transactions. Must have leadership abilities and a desire to grow and support a team in a global business environment.
At least 5 years of direct working experience in the related field is required for this position. Excellent Excel skills and the ability to create production costing models for budgeting & forecasting.
Experience in Administration & HR or sourcing and generating POs for purchasing will be a high advantage, otherwise a strong willingness to gain knowledge, especially in the HR scope of a production-oriented organization.
High proficiency in Microsoft Navision is preferred, with the ability to operate accounting information systems efficiently and effectively. Must be able to be a lead user of the system and guide supporting colleagues on financial elements.
Participate in budgeting/forecasting activities and provide accurate and timely tax/financial reports to relevant authorities.
Great attitude, team player personality to be groomed for leading expertise, well-organized multitasker, fast learner with great attention to detail, and a pleasant personality to work across a young team. Other ad-hoc duties as required with an entrepreneurial spirit to take on new tasks and challenges.
